Output 0ab2817783eb5ff8373a9b6fd4ba75e65e1768c8fa31dfe1b0f1c2dde5f071e7:0

value
24987889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1281a31076dd1048d73eff741141d6f859f8f252 OP_EQUAL
address
33NsPLAhE8EdijxbwZRswq9Ar1L8J7FU1x
transaction
0ab2817783eb5ff8373a9b6fd4ba75e65e1768c8fa31dfe1b0f1c2dde5f071e7
confirmations
22491
spent
true